Bold Exterior Design – Rugged Yet Premium

The Jetour G700 grabs attention the moment it hits the road. Built on Chery’s Kunpeng Super Power platform, the SUV exudes a confident presence with its upright stance, sharp LED headlights, bold chrome-accented grille, and sculpted body lines.

  • Dimensions: With a length of 5,230 mm, width of 2,003 mm, height of 1,930 mm, and a wheelbase of 3,000 mm, the G700 is a full-sized SUV that rivals global heavyweights like the Toyota Land Cruiser and Jeep Grand Cherokee.
  • Wheels: The SUV rides on large alloy wheels with a striking multi-spoke design that not only look premium but also aid in stability during off-road drives.
  • Lighting: Sleek LED DRLs, 3D tail lamps, and dynamic indicators highlight its futuristic appeal.
  • Roof Options: The panoramic sunroof enhances cabin airiness, making long journeys more comfortable for families.

This design language reflects both luxury and adventure, appealing equally to city drivers and off-road enthusiasts.

Luxurious & Tech-Loaded Interior

Step inside the Jetour G700, and you’re greeted with a plush interior that matches premium European SUVs.

  • Seating: Available in both 6-seater (captain chairs) and 7-seater configurations, it ensures flexibility for families and adventure seekers alike.
  • Material Quality: Premium leather upholstery, soft-touch panels, ambient lighting, and brushed aluminum inserts give the cabin a first-class feel.
  • Dashboard: A massive dual-screen setup dominates the dashboard – a 15.6-inch central touchscreen paired with a 12.3-inch digital instrument cluster.
  • Infotainment: Powered by the Snapdragon 8155 chip, the system supports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and AI-based voice commands.
  • Sound System: A Dolby Atmos premium audio system turns the cabin into a concert hall, delivering crystal-clear music for all passengers.
  • Practicality: With multiple storage spaces, wireless charging pads, and USB-C ports across all rows, it is built with modern family convenience in mind.

Engine & Performance – Power Meets Efficiency

Under the hood, the Jetour G700 (4WD) is a plug-in hybrid powerhouse that blends raw power with eco-friendliness.

  • Engine: A 1.5L turbocharged petrol engine paired with dual electric motors.
  • Total Output: A jaw-dropping 904 Ps (approx. 892 hp) and 1280 Nm of torque, placing it among the most powerful hybrid SUVs in the world.
  • Transmission: Equipped with a 3-speed DHT (Dedicated Hybrid Transmission), ensuring seamless gear shifts.
  • Drive System: Advanced 4WD system with multiple terrain modes (snow, sand, mud, rock, eco, sport) to tackle diverse driving conditions.
  • Acceleration: 0-100 km/h in just 4.5 seconds, remarkable for a 7-seater SUV.
  • Top Speed: Electronically limited to 200 km/h.
  • EV Mode Range: Up to 200 km in pure electric mode, making it ideal for city commutes without using fuel.
  • Hybrid Range: Over 1,200 km combined range, ensuring stress-free long journeys.

This combination of brute power and efficiency makes the G700 stand out in the hybrid SUV segment.

Advanced Safety Features

Safety remains a top priority for Jetour, and the G700 is loaded with advanced driver assistance systems.

  • Level 2+ ADAS including ad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, blind-spot detection, and autonomous emergency braking.
  • 360-Degree Camera & Transparent Chassis View for tackling tight city spots and tricky off-road terrain.
  • 12 Ultrasonic Radars & 9 High-Resolution Cameras for superior situational awareness.
  • Automatic Parking Assist that allows the SUV to park itself with minimal driver input.
  • Airbags: 8-airbag system with reinforced body structure for maximum crash protection.

With these features, the Jetour G700 ensures peace of mind for both drivers and passengers.

Expected Price & Rivals

While Jetour has not officially revealed global pricing, industry estimates suggest that the Jetour G700 (4WD) could be priced around ₹65–75 lakh in India (ex-showroom) if launched, or USD $60,000–70,000 in international markets.

Main Rivals:

  • Toyota Land Cruiser Prado
  • Jeep Grand Cherokee 4xe
  • BYD Yangwang U8
  • Land Rover Defender PHEV
